As an undergrad, I loved Willard's General Topology.  People seem
to think it is too hard for today's undergraduates, unfortunately.

What I liked was its completeness:  define topologies via open sets,
nhood systems, bases, closed sets, closure operator, interior operator
and show they're all equivalent.  Nets and filters and their equivalence.
T_0, T_1, T_2, T_3, T_3+1/2, T_4, regular, completely regular, normal.
The varieties of connectedness and of compactness.  

It's a very nice workout in playing with sets and logic.

All the other texts seem incomplete in comparison.  


